Autumn Fashion Trends to Style

As the air starts to shift and the first hints of fall creep in, so does the excitement of a new fashion season. Fall 2026 is shaping up to be a mix of nostalgic revivals and modern structure. Where statement silhouettes meet everyday wearability. The trends we have our eye on this year strike that perfect balance between bold and functional, giving you plenty of room to experiment while still building a wardrobe that works for real life. From reimagined classics to standout layering pieces, here’s what we’re loving right now. 

Peplum Returns 


Peplum is officially back, but not in the way you might remember. This time around, the silhouette feels sharper, more tailored, and less overly flared. Designers are incorporating subtle structure into blazers, tops, and even lightweight jackets, creating a cinched waist effect that instantly elevates an outfit. It’s a flattering, feminine detail that pairs effortlessly with straight-leg trousers or even relaxed denim, making it much more wearable for everyday styling.

Cropped Cuts


Cropped silhouettes are continuing their reign into fall, and we’re seeing them across everything from jackets to knits. Cropped blazers and sweaters add dimension to layered looks, especially when styled with high-waisted pants or skirts. This trend is perfect for transitional weather. It gives you coverage while still feeling light and intentional. It’s also an easy way to show off proportions and create a more styled, put-together look without much effort.

Art Deco-Inspired Details


There’s a quiet glamour weaving its way into fall fashion through art deco influences. Think geometric patterns, metallic accents, rich textures, and intricate embellishments that feel both vintage and futuristic. These pieces are perfect for elevating your wardrobe, whether it’s through a statement top, a patterned dress, or even accessories. The key here is subtle impact—letting one art deco-inspired piece do the talking while the rest of your outfit stays minimal.

Ponchos


Outerwear is taking a softer, more dramatic turn with the return of the poncho. Effortless yet bold, ponchos are becoming the go-to layering piece for fall. They offer movement, comfort, and a sense of ease that structured coats sometimes lack. Whether draped over a simple outfit or layered for extra warmth, ponchos instantly add depth and texture. Neutral tones keep things classic, while patterned options can serve as a statement piece.

Funnel Neck Jackets


If there’s one outerwear trend that feels both practical and elevated, it’s the funnel neck jacket. With its high, structured neckline, this silhouette not only adds a modern edge but also provides extra warmth on chilly days. It’s a sleek alternative to bulkier scarves and layers beautifully over both casual and dressed-up looks. Expect to see these in everything from wool coats to lightweight transitional jackets.

Capris


Capris are stepping back into the spotlight this fall, and yes, they’re more wearable than ever. Styled correctly, they can feel incredibly chic and polished. The key is in the tailoring: think slim, structured cuts paired with boots, heels, or even sleek flats. When balanced with oversized knits or structured outerwear, capris create a fresh silhouette that stands out from the usual fall uniform.

Plaid, Reinvented


Plaid is a fall staple, but this season it’s getting a refresh. Instead of traditional patterns, we’re seeing unexpected color combinations, oversized prints, and mixed textures. Plaid is showing up on everything. Such as coats, skirts, trousers, and even accessories, making it easy to incorporate into your wardrobe at any level. Whether you go bold with a statement piece or keep it subtle, plaid remains a timeless trend with endless versatility.

Fall 2026 fashion is all about playing with shape, texture, and detail while still keeping things wearable. These trends aren’t about completely reinventing your wardrobe. They’re about updating it with pieces that feel current and exciting. Whether you’re drawn to the structure of peplum, the ease of ponchos, or the statement of art deco details, there’s something this season for every personal style.
